July 2007
Jessie Lee Miller has just recorded her second album called "Waiting" that was to be released August 2007.
This past year her train has started chugging her career along to a rapidly progressing speed. Riding on the tracks
of her last album, "Now You're Gonna Be Loved", Jessie has begun to travel to her fans instead of just
performing in her home town of Austin, Texas.
In August she performed in Montreal Canada at the Red Hot and Blue Festival, then returned to her regular gigs in Austin.
September had her performing in a string of gigs across Europe, beginning in Belgium and ending in Switzerland.
Jessie's latest album has a new twist she's added by acting as her own Producer:
"I have never produced an album before, so I was a little nervous, but in the end I was glad I chose to do so.
It gave me complete creative control, and although I had some weak spots and hard lessons, I think all in all it
went very smoothly. And when I hear the songs, I know it is exactly the sound and translation I intended. We
recorded the last album in one day, and this one we recorded in two. In a perfect world, I'd spend a week, but
that'll be a future goal."
"I write a lot of my own music and it is important for me to be involved in the musical translation and
the life each song takes on. Music is my passion, and I treat it with respect, and handle it delicately when
constructing it. I am thankful for the musicians that played on this album and feel they gave a stellar
performance. I look forward to seeing where this album leads us. Now my hope is that my fans feel the love
I do for this album. It is straight from my heart to theirs.I look forward to sharing this next year with
all of you. Feel free to walk right up and say hello!"

out her latest CD, available worldwide, featuring artist such as Floyd Domino on piano, Rick McRae
on guitar, Will Indian on guitar, Olivier Giraud from Paris 49 playing guitar on a few ballad numbers, Stanley
Smith from Jazz Pharoes on clarinet, and Cindy Cashdollar swingin' it on steel while breaking hearts on Dobro. Eric
Hokanen stirs it up with the fiddle, John Gill and Karen Biller keep the rhythm steady on percussion, Rick Ramirez
plays upright bass, and Rick White on trumpet lends the spice of a latino sound to the song "Loved By You."
"Waiting" was recording July 15th and 16th at the Wire Studio in Austin, Texas. Engineered
by Brad Bell, and mastered by Stuart Sullivan. |
